Abstract

The current paper recovers hybrid solitary waves for double–layered shallow water waves with the basic platform being the mKdV equation. The selected models are the Zaremaoghaddam equation and the Gear–Grimshaw equation. The integration algorithm adopted is the generalized exponential differential function method. This yields hybrid waves that emerge from solitary waves, shock waves and the singular solitary waves. The existence criteria for such waves are also presented as parameter constraints.
